Brief summary

Objective: To evaluate the efficacy of intra-articular hyaluronic acid (HA) injections for the treatment of adhesive capsulitis (AC) of the shoulder. Design: Prospective, randomized, parallel-group interventional trial Setting: Rehabilitation department of a medical center hospital. Participants: Participants: Patients with frozen-phase primary adhesive capsulitis Interventions: The patients received intra-articular glenohumeral joint injections of HA, 60mg, once per week for 3 consecutive weeks. Main Outcome Measures: Active and passive range of motion (ROM) of the affected shoulder; Shoulder pain and disability were measured using 2 questionnaires: the SPADI. The patients were evaluated before treatment and were reevaluated 4, 6, 8, and 26 weeks after the beginning of the treatment.

Inclusion criteria

* Patients diagnosed with frozen shoulder by a clinical physician based on the patient's medical history, physical examination, X-ray, and ultrasound or magnetic resonance imaging reports. * Clinical course: Patients must have a pain score of less than 3, no nighttime shoulder pain, and be in the post-freezing stage, primarily presenting restricted shoulder joint range of motion. * The affected shoulder joint must have at least two angles of shoulder joint movement reduced by at least 30% compared to the healthy side: shoulder flexion, abduction, and external rotation, or a single affected side abduction angle reduced by 50% relative to the healthy side. * Age between 40 to 70 years old.

Exclusion criteria

* full-thickness tear or massive tear of the rotator cuff tendons or calcific tendinitis. * Presence of systemic rheumatic disease. * History of shoulder fracture or previous shoulder surgery. * Received shoulder injections for treatment within the last 3 months. * Acute cervical nerve root compression. * Current pregnancy or lactation. * Patients with shoulder instability or cancer. * Patients with cognitive impairment, unable to follow simple instructions, or unable to comply with the study procedures.

Design outcomes

Primary

MeasureTime frameDescription
Shoulder Pain and Disability Indexbaseline, 4, 6, 8, and 26 weeks after treatment initiationThe SPADI consists of two subscales, pain, and disability, comprising a total of 13 items. Each item is rated on a scale from 0 (no pain/disability) to 10 (most severe pain/disability). Higher scores indicate greater functional impairment. The total score on the SPADI is used to determine the percentage of functional disability

Secondary

MeasureTime frameDescription
Range of Motionbaseline, 4, 6, 8, and 26 weeks after treatment initiationThe ROM is assessed using a standardized goniometer in the standard position to measure the angles of shoulder joint movement on the affected side. It includes flexion, extension, abduction, external rotation, and internal rotation.
